Trial Close
A trial close is a sales technique where the salesperson asks a potential buyer a question that assumes the sale has been made to gauge their readiness to complete the purchase.
Selling Process
A series of steps or stages followed by sales professionals to identify prospective clients, engage them, and ultimately close a sale.
Sales Presentation
A structured pitch or demonstration aimed at persuading a potential client to purchase a product or service.
